写点什么

语义变焦(Semantic Zoom)改善用户体验

  • 2012-09-19
  • 本文字数:623 字

    阅读完需:约 2 分钟

语义变焦(Semantic Zoom)是 Windows8 上一个新的触摸优化功能,它用新的视角来呈现和导航大量数据内容,利用延时加载来控制数据的展示。因此,它可以作为大批量数据的容器,用来展示单一或大数据集。通过语义变焦,用户可以使用“放大”来关注单一记录,使用“缩小”用其他想要的视角来查看一组数据。从这个意义上,用户能够选择数据组或部分、“放大”然后自动导航到选中的记录。

实现 ISemanticZoomInformation IZoomableView 的接口才能使用语义变焦。截至本文写作之时,仅GridView 和ListView 两种视图实现。此外,这两种视图可以根据用户操作来互相切换。

微软开发者布道师Jerry Nixon 指出:“语义变焦只是通过两种视角来展示数据,并没有改变数据范围”。用触摸式界面提供的捏放手势和鼠标滑轮结合Control 键都可以执行语义变焦,作为可选的,也可用Ctrl+ 和Ctrl- 两个组合键。

语义变焦不同于排列图像时为让图像局部放大而用鼠标滑轮做的缩放操作。另外一方面,它也不同于为放大特别位置(例如Bing 地图)上某些内容用鼠标做的光学变焦。

Developer Express 公司软件工程师 Mehul Harry 指出“语义变焦是很酷的功能, Windows 8 平台一定会让我们兴奋不已”。

英文原文: http://www.infoq.com/news/2012/08/Semantic-Zoom


感谢贾国清对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 )或者腾讯微博( @InfoQ )关注我们,并与我们的编辑和其他读者朋友交流。

2012-09-19 03:132871

评论

发布
暂无评论
发现更多内容

LeetCode 769. Max Chunks To Make Sorted

liu_liu

LeetCode

极客时间-架构师培训-1期作业

Damon

SpringBatch系列之并发并行能力

稻草鸟人

Spring Boot SpringBatch 批量

Flink源码分析之Flink是如何kafka读取数据的

shengjk1

flink flink 消费 kafka flink源码分析 flink消费kafka源码解析

每周学习总结-架构师培训一期

Damon

架构师训练营第一周作业

小树林

食堂就餐卡管理系统

孙志平

程序员陪娃系列——数学启蒙趣事

孙苏勇

程序员 陪伴

食堂就餐卡系统设计

刘志刚

【ARTS打卡】Week02

Rex

架构师训练营-命题作业1

水边

极客大学架构师训练营

架构方法学习总结

飞雪

Flink源码分析之-如何保存 offset

shengjk1

Flink源码分析之Flink 自定义source、sink 是如何起作用的

shengjk1

flink flink源码 flink源码分析 flink自定义source flink自定义sink

ARTS-WEEK2

一周思进

ARTS 打卡计划

食堂就餐卡系统设计

飞雪

因为 MongoDB 没入门,我丢了一份实习工作

沉默王二

mongodb

不可不知的 7 个 JDK 命令

武培轩

Java 程序员 jdk 后端 JVM

dnsmasq-域名访问及解析缓存

一周思进

ARTS打卡 week 2

猫吃小怪兽

ARTS 打卡计划

架构师训练营-每周学习总结1

水边

极客大学架构师训练营

架构师训练营第一周作业

芒夏

极客大学架构师训练营

愚蠢写作术(3):如何把读者带入迷宫深处

史方远

学习 读书笔记 个人成长 写作

程序员的晚餐 | 6 月 7 日 豆腐年糕

清远

美食

Flink源码分析之Flink startupMode是如何起作用的

shengjk1

flink flink 消费 kafak 实时计算 flink源码 flink源码分析

人人都是产品经理

二鱼先生

产品经理 个人品牌 职场成长 产品思维

SpringBoot基本特性以及自动化配置-SPI机制

攀岩飞鱼

Java 微服务 Spring Boot SpringCloud

Flink源码分析之FlinkConsumer是如何保证一个partition对应一个thread的

shengjk1

flink flink 消费 kafka 实时计算 flink源码分析

食堂就餐卡系统设计

饶军

Element-UI实战系列:Tree组件的几种使用场景

AR7

vue.js 大前端 Elemen

架构师训练营第一周学习总结

刘志刚

语义变焦(Semantic Zoom)改善用户体验_.NET_Anand Narayanaswamy_InfoQ精选文章